This recipe was extracted from A practical cook and text book for general use (1896) by Ellen Goodell Smith, page 30.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.

three level teacups of entire wheat flour, and three level teaspoons of baking powder ; add to th's, one and one-half teacups cold water and one 78 THE FAT OF THE LAND. table-Spoonful of vegetable butter, stir it thoroughly- together as rapidly as possible and drop from spoon on an oiled baking plate or pan, or into warm, not hotgtm pans ; this will make twelve biscuits ; dip a spoon in oil or cold water press them lightly to shape them, and put in a hot oven ; bake fifteen or twenty minutes or until done. They should rise very quickly and bake without scorching. Equal parts of white flour and entire wheat may be used for these biscuit, or entire wheat and light gluten in equal parts. Shortcake. Made the same as biscuit, with the addi- tion of a little more shortening
